1. Reliability and Uptime
Your website should be available to visitors 24/7. Downtime can cost you lost traffic, potential customers, and even damage your reputation. Look for a web host that offers at least 99.9% uptime and has a strong track record of reliability.
Some hosting providers oversell their servers, leading to slower performance and occasional outages. Choosing a provider that prioritizes uptime and stability will ensure that your website is always accessible.
2. Website Speed and Performance
Page speed is a critical factor for both user experience and SEO rankings. A slow-loading website can frustrate visitors and cause them to leave before even seeing your content.
When evaluating a hosting provider, consider:
- Server Speed & Location: Faster servers with well-placed data centers improve load times.
- Caching & Optimization: Built-in caching can significantly improve performance.
- Content Delivery Network (CDN): A CDN helps distribute your website’s content across multiple locations, reducing load times for global visitors.
A well-optimized hosting solution will ensure your website runs fast and efficiently, no matter where your audience is located.
3. Security & Backups
Cybersecurity is a major concern for any website owner. A good hosting provider will include essential security features such as:
- SSL Certificates – Encrypts data and secures user transactions.
- Malware Scanning & Firewalls – Protects against hacks and cyber threats.
- Automatic Backups – Ensures your data is safe in case of unexpected issues.
Many hosting providers offer basic security, but a fully managed hosting plan can take care of security updates, malware protection, and regular backups for you—giving you peace of mind.
4. Scalability & Growth
Your website’s hosting needs might change over time. Whether you start with a simple blog or an eCommerce store, choosing a scalable hosting provider will ensure your website can grow without performance issues.
Look for:
- Flexible resource allocation – Can the hosting plan handle increased traffic?
- Easy upgrades – Can you seamlessly switch to a higher-tier plan when needed?
- Support for future features – Does the host support modern technologies like PHP 8, databases, and caching systems?
A scalable hosting solution allows your business to grow without worrying about downtime or slow performance.
5. Support & Website Management
Even if you’re comfortable managing a website, having reliable technical support is invaluable. If something goes wrong, you’ll want a hosting provider that offers:
- Fast response times – How quickly does the support team respond?
- Expert assistance – Do they provide hands-on troubleshooting?
- Ongoing maintenance – Can they handle updates, security patches, and backups for you?
Some hosting providers offer fully managed hosting, where maintenance, updates, and troubleshooting are all handled for you—allowing you to focus on growing your business rather than dealing with technical issues.
